Propylene-ethylene copolymer compositions suitable for hot fill packaging of foodstuffs

1. A propylene-ethylene copolymer comprising:
propylene as a primary monomer;
an ethylene content (ET) of from 2.0% to 5% by weight;
a melt flow rate greater than 45 g/10 min and less than 100 g/10 min;
a xylene soluble fraction (XS) of from 2.0% to 7.0% by weight; and
a xylene soluble fraction to ethylene content ratio (XS/ET) of less than or equal to 1.51.
